Prime Minister Pashinyan attends WWII Victory Day parade in Moscow

Armenian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an on May 9 in Moscow attended the military parade dedicated to the 80th anniversary of the victory in WWII.
Before the parade, Russian President Vladimir Putin welcomed PM Pashinyan and other visiting world leaders in the Kremlin, the Prime Minister’s Office said in a press release.
After the parade the world leaders laid flowers at the Tomb of the Unknown Soldier.
